A few months before my particular sailing last month, the 14 day unlimited was being sold in cruise planner at $199, closer to sailing it went up to $269 and as I posted earlier, on board it was $319. There was no discount the first day in the I lounge, I had earlier heard reports of this but I went down there to check it out and no deal.

On the day we boarded we went to I lounge. Since we had not logged on yet and claimed our Elite free minutes we were offered the $319 14 day unlimited package at a cost of $223 total (30% discount). If we had signed up from our room and gotten the free minutes not sure if this offer works. The fellow in the I lounge said we could only get it if we signed up direct in the I lounge. We took it immediately and without a doubt this was the fastest connection at sea we have ever had. Amazingly it did not make much difference what time of day it was nor if it was a port vs sea day. For those who regularly need to be on line you can appreciate how unusual this in itself is.

 

I had no way of measuring actual download speeds but my gut feel is it was 30% to 40% of the speed we have at home on our Time Warner/Brighthouse cable connection via wireless modem connection...we were amazed at this speed on a ship. Also $16 dollars a day not terrible either and if we wanted to we could Skype (Celebrity promotes this actually) but did not attempt this due to the time difference in the Med vs .the US.

Just found a Price List pdf from Celebrity with a small date of 9/2016 at the bottom

http://creative.rccl.com/Sales/Celebrity/General_Info/Flyers/16049912_CEL_Xcelerate_Trade_Flyer.pdf

 

Package Cruise Length Pre-Cruise Price (USD) Onboard Price (USD)

1 Hour(continuous use) N/A N/A $24.95

24 hours N/A N/A $49

Unlimited 2 - 3 days $75 $84

Unlimited 4 - 6 days $147 $164

Unlimited 7 - 9 days $237 $264

Unlimited 10 - 13 days $282 $314

Unlimited 14+ days $309 $344

Guests will receive 10% off if they book package pre cruise.

*Per minute package is no longer available

Clients can purchase select Xcelerate packages pre-cruise or the full selection once on board.

 

 

It looks like the prices increased since July 2016 based on the cached page where 7-9 days was $199 onboard. I noticed the price change in early October, so I'm guessing the price change is across the board for upcoming sailings.

http://webcache.googleusercontent.com/search?q=cache:Pp4xdIKpqxYJ:creative.rccl.com/Sales/Celebrity/General_Info/Flyers/16049913_CEL_Xcelerate_Consumer_Flyer.pdf+&cd=8&hl=en&ct=clnk&gl=us

Package Cruise Length Pre-Cruise Price Onboard Price

Per minute N/A N/A $0.99

24 hours N/A N/A $45

Unlimited 2 - 3 days $59 $69

Unlimited 4 - 6 days $129 $149

Unlimited 7 - 9 days $179 $199

Unlimited 10 - 13 days $269 $299

Unlimited 14+ days $269 $299

 

If this is the case, I might just by 2 24-hour packages in between port days rather than $344 - Status discount. That is quite the price hike! If increasing the price helps reduce subscribers to maintain reasonable speeds, well, that's great for those who get it in a package or need unlimited, but the new prices for 7-9 nights is significant increase

Package Cruise Length Pre-Cruise Price [OLD NEW %INCREASE] Onboard Price [OLD NEW %INCREASE]

24 hours [N/A N/A N/A] [$45 $49 8.89]

Unlimited 2 - 3 days [$59 $75 27.12] [$69 $84 21.74]

Unlimited 4 - 6 days [$129 $147 13.95] [$149 $164 10.07]

Unlimited 7 - 9 days [$179 $237 32.40] [$199 $264 32.66]

Unlimited 10 - 13 days [$269 $282 4.83] [$299 $314 5.02]

Unlimited 14+ days [$269 $309 14.87] [$299 $344 15.05]

I am on Reflection right now for a seven day cruise and they are charging $249 for unlimited internet. More outrageous than I thought. With the Elite Plus discount it is $162. Still too high. So a friend in my group and I are sharing one unlimited package. It will cost me $81. I think Celebrity is shooting themselves in the foot. If the packages were priced like Royal's Voom I would have bought my own package and they would have more revenue.
